#ifndef _HV_KBD_H
#define _HV_KBD_H
#include <sys/param.h>
#include <sys/lock.h>
#include <sys/mutex.h>
#include <sys/queue.h>
#include <sys/systm.h>

#include <dev/kbd/kbdreg.h>

#include "opt_evdev.h"
#ifdef EVDEV_SUPPORT
#include <dev/evdev/evdev.h>
#include <dev/evdev/input.h>
#endif

#define HVKBD_DRIVER_NAME       "hvkbd"
#define IS_UNICODE              (1)
#define IS_BREAK                (2)
#define IS_E0                   (4)
#define IS_E1                   (8)

#define XTKBD_EMUL0             (0xe0)
#define XTKBD_EMUL1             (0xe1)
#define XTKBD_RELEASE           (0x80)

#define DEBUG_HVSC(sc, ...) do {                        \
        if (sc->debug > 0) {                            \
                device_printf(sc->dev, __VA_ARGS__);    \
        }                                               \
} while (0)
#define DEBUG_HVKBD(kbd, ...) do {                      \
        hv_kbd_sc *sc = (kbd)->kb_data;                 \
        DEBUG_HVSC(sc, __VA_ARGS__);                            \
} while (0)

struct vmbus_channel;
struct vmbus_xact_ctx;

typedef struct keystroke_t {
        uint16_t                        makecode;
        uint32_t                        info;
} keystroke;

typedef struct keystroke_info {
        LIST_ENTRY(keystroke_info)      link;
        STAILQ_ENTRY(keystroke_info)    slink;
        keystroke                       ks;
} keystroke_info;

typedef struct hv_kbd_sc_t {
        struct vmbus_channel            *hs_chan;
        device_t                        dev;
        struct vmbus_xact_ctx           *hs_xact_ctx;
        int32_t                         buflen;
        uint8_t                         *buf;

        struct mtx                      ks_mtx;
        LIST_HEAD(, keystroke_info)     ks_free_list;
        STAILQ_HEAD(, keystroke_info)   ks_queue;       /* keystroke info queue */

        keyboard_t                      sc_kbd;
        int                             sc_mode;
        int                             sc_state;
        uint32_t                        sc_accents;     /* accent key index (> 0) */
        uint32_t                        sc_composed_char; /* composed char code */
        uint8_t                         sc_prefix;      /* AT scan code prefix */
        int                             sc_polling;     /* polling recursion count */
        uint32_t                        sc_flags;
        int                             debug;

#ifdef EVDEV_SUPPORT
        struct evdev_dev                *ks_evdev;
        int                             ks_evdev_state;
#endif
} hv_kbd_sc;

int     hv_kbd_produce_ks(hv_kbd_sc *sc, const keystroke *ks);
int     hv_kbd_fetch_top(hv_kbd_sc *sc, keystroke *top);
int     hv_kbd_modify_top(hv_kbd_sc *sc, keystroke *top);
int     hv_kbd_remove_top(hv_kbd_sc *sc);
int     hv_kbd_prod_is_ready(hv_kbd_sc *sc);
void    hv_kbd_read_channel(struct vmbus_channel *, void *);

int     hv_kbd_drv_attach(device_t dev);
int     hv_kbd_drv_detach(device_t dev);

int     hvkbd_driver_load(module_t, int, void *);
void    hv_kbd_intr(hv_kbd_sc *sc);
#endif
